Russian attack damaged two civilian ships and HHLA terminal
On March 1, 2025, at 6 p.m. a Russian ballistic missile strike damaged the 'MSC Levante F' at berth 2 in the port of Odesa and port facilities and some containers in the container yard. Two port employees sustained injuries in the attack, who worked at the Hamburger Hafen und Logistik AG (HHLA) terminal. They were rushed to hospital in stable condition. The damage was currently being investigated on site. Operations at the terminal have been suspended, but were expected to resume shortly. The HHLA handles containers and other goods such as grain there. The freighter was only carrying civilian goods. The container ship sustained some minor damage like broken portholes, mainly from the impact of the shock wave. The crew remained unharmed, and the vessel safely sailed from Odessa on March 4. Odessa only recently had resumed container shipping operations after years of shutdown caused by Russian targeting of civilian shipping. Russia has repeatedly attacked merchant vessels, particularly in the early months of its invasion in 2022, and it has used missile and drone strikes to damage port infrastructure in the Odesa region and along the Ukrainian segment of the Danube. Also the bulk carrier 'Super Sarkas' was damaged, which had more than 21,000 tons of corn and soyabeans for export on board. The Super Sarkas' also sustained minor damage and has also left Odessa as of March 4.
